The New Cybersecurity Vanguard: A Game-Changing Addition
In an era where cybersecurity threats are ceaselessly advancing, companies are racing to bolster their defenses and leadership. Most recently, Omega Systems, a leading player, has made a strategic move. The firm has added former Redpoint Cybersecurity CEO, Safirstein, to their team as a cyber solutions leader.
This addition comes at a time when cyber threats are increasingly complex and frequent, underscoring the urgency of strong cybersecurity leadership. Safirstein’s appointment is a testament to the growing importance organizations are placing on cybersecurity, signaling a shift in the industry’s landscape.
The Unfolding Story: A Strategic Appointee for a Dynamic Field
Safirstein, a seasoned veteran in the cybersecurity arena, brings a wealth of experience to Omega Systems. His tenure as CEO of Redpoint Cybersecurity saw significant advances in cyber threat detection and prevention. His leadership in developing innovative cyber solutions will now drive Omega Systems’ defensive strategies.

Regulatory Repercussions: Balancing Legalities and Ethics
The integration of high-level cybersecurity leadership into corporate structures also signals a response to tightening regulations around data protection and privacy. Companies failing to adequately protect their systems can face hefty fines under laws like GDPR, making the appointment of experienced leaders like Safirstein a wise move legally and ethically.
